Output 5316fe8f81a2818736d7508302d22cd4d6e60d09d4cea3b63ae0f38fa48bdeb7:0

value
2025847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b52633032353e6ca2d9541b0d474a0a1f459d460 OP_EQUAL
address
3JCqzPxXz97n7xhLt656Y3eQPLkBw8rSBc
transaction
5316fe8f81a2818736d7508302d22cd4d6e60d09d4cea3b63ae0f38fa48bdeb7
spent
true